Abstract
Purpose: Green supply chain management (GSCM) has important purposes related to environmental performance, such as risk control, meeting marketplace expectations, achieving good commercial enterprise performance and complying with regulations. Since green supply chain management (GSCM) has been rapidly evolved since the first introduction in 1980 era. Most of the published papers are focusing on the performance measurement and evaluation of stakeholders but there are more areas that can be discussed. This paper is intended to investigate the factors that affecting the awareness level of GSCM implementation.
Design/methodology/approach: A systematic literature review has been made on several selected journal papers related to GSCM practices. These articles are mainly discussing the factors that affecting the adoption and implementation of GSCM in an organization.
Findings: From literature review, a total of twelve factors have been identified that will affect the implementation of GSCM and these factors can be categorised into four main categories which are the internal motivating, external motivating, internal demotivating and external demotivating.
Research limitations/implications: This study is filling the gap in the literature about the adoption and implementation of GSCM in construction industry.
Practical implications: Findings from this study will assist GSCM practitioners, authorities and stakeholders in the supply chain in construction industry to insight into key factors of GSCM.
Originality/value: A systematic literature review which assessing the factors that affecting the implementation and adoption of GSCM in Malaysia’s construction industry which is not attempted previously.
